I was quite sceptical about using an external antenna to improve the quality of my 4G connection (Huawei E3272 dongle) -- having read some articles on the Internet that painted rather bleak picture of the effectiveness of such solution. However, since my mobile connection indoors is absolutely rubbish (even though both EE and Three claim excellent 4G coverage here, both indoors and outdoors), I decided to give it a try.And I am rather glad I did -- the improvement is VERY noticeable. My Three connection used to be absolutely atrocious (weak 3G, download speed fluctuating between 64-128kbps on average) -- with the antenna attached I now get a strong 3G/weak 4G signal with download speeds between 1 and 4 Mbps. When using EE results are even better - went from weak to strong 4G and download speeds improved from around 1Mbps to 20+ Mbps, making the EE4G an interesting alternative for my ADSL2+ broadband.

£28.99's worth of it.I was VERY sceptical of this device to say the least but id thought id take a gamble. Worst case scenario the thing wouldnt/didn't work as advertised and i can send it back to Amazon for a refund which I am currently in the process of.I am using a Huawei E392 getting 3-4 bars on Three 4G but I felt a little greedy and thought maybe i could get a little more speed if i could improve the signal a little more.did nothing to improve my signal, just made things worse. added 10-20ms to my ping and dropped down & upload speeds dramatically. my average DL is around 8-10mb/s & 8-15mb/s UL, Having this thing attached dropped my DL speeds to barely 2mb/s quite often then not teetering around the 1.5mb/s mark. UL speeds fell to about 3-4mb/s.I experimented with both TS9 plugs attached then running with a single plug to see if it made any difference & there was no change at all.While mobile broadband speeds are always inconsistent depending on the time of the day & pretty much the network itself. I ran multiple tests during the morning, afternoon & the evening during off peak hours & the result was always the same. My E392 is much much better without this peice of junk attached.If youre in an area where 4G signal is extremely weak then maybe it would help a little, Otherwise avoid this product at all costs.

The aerial is quite easy to set up, at least with my Huawei E5372 4G which exposes two hidden sockets for the dual plugs. Stick the antenna to your window pane or place it on a flat surface, pointing at your ISP's transmitter. You then start receiving 4G Internet Service at a fairly high rate (I get 65Mbs from 3 in North Doncaster, UK), assuming you have checked that the aerial is compatible with your internet service and signal.
